Abstract
: The performed studies substantiate the existence of a source of renewable ultrapress water and hydrocarbons in rift geodynamic conditions. The studies are carried out on the basis of the developed principles of structural and hydrogeological analysis and the results of thermodynamic simulation using the Selector software The revealed regularity allows us to conclude that the most studied natural resources necessary for mankind owe their origin to the same geological processes that accompany modern degassing of the planet.
